ich habe nachfolgenden Code auf dem entsprechenden Worksheet hinterlegt.
Die Umrandung der angeklickten Zeile für den Bereich von 6 Spalten funktioniert unter Office 10 einwandfrei. Jetzt haben wir auf Office 365 umgestellt und nun weicht der Rahmen je weiter man in der Liste nach unten kommt von der tatsächlich aktiven Zeile ab.
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Range("M1") = 1 Then
With ActiveSheet.Shapes("Rectangle 1")
.Top = ActiveCell.Top - 1
.Left = 1
.Width = Columns(7).Left
.Height = ActiveCell.Height + 1
End With
End If
End Sub
Ich habe eine Demo-Datei hochgeladen. Das Problem wird ab Zeile 10 sichtbar, wenn man sich Zeile für Zeile nach unten bewegt.https://www.herber.de/bbs/user/155189.xlsm
Hat jemand eine Idee, woran dies liegen kann und wie der Code angepasst werden muss ?
Vielen Dank für die Unterstützung
Gert